i don't get the 'affordable' argument.

My grandparents have a caravan, paid around £5,000 for it!! Their value goes down like a car, you have to pay to camp, looking at Eurotrip it was expensive, they charge you per person, then per car, then caravan size, then charge you for water and electric. You are also often well outside the town or city and is a 20 min drive and parking costs to explore

You get awful mpg when towing something the size of a caravan, you can't go over 65 mph....

You the have all the gear you have to take, which again costs more money... empty the toilet every few days  :o

When I was travelling in America, sharing costs with a friend. I paid around £30 a night to stay in Marriott hotels, which had free internet, air-con, and free breakfast the hotels were right in the centre of the city!

I spent around 2 weeks so far in them, their points scheme is very good. I already have enough points for 2 free nights!
